On 08/29/2012 02:49 PM, Stéphane Bidoul (Acsone) wrote: > The reason I asked for the change is that we are migrating to 6.1 and both > in 6.0 and 7.0 the Projects menu is not in the configuration section. Maybe > the design decision was reverted in 7.0?
Not really. The form view of Projects is still considered configuration data because a Project is not a working document, in the sense that tasks or sale orders are. It's more similar to Financial Journals or Sale Shops, something you configure once as a "framework" or "category" for daily operations that are then done with tasks / issues. Project Managers may need to view them on a daily basis, but probably more for reporting than for editing, and there are other ways to access reporting features (such as grouping the tasks/issues/timesheets by project, or using Analysis views). Project Managers also have access to the configuration menu, so it's simply a matter of usability/taste (2 very subjective topics indeed). In 7.0 the Projects menu was reintroduced at the top-level because it is now a gateway to the high-level project management kanban view, that gives direct access to tasks and issues. "Projects" in this case is the generic gateway for "Project-related documents", it does not lead only to the project list/form config views in the classical (6.0) sense. > Admitedly its not a big deal, but > honestly, project managers need to access the projects on a daily basis and > putting it under configuration is really weird. It's quite logical, based on the above rationale. In any case you can imagine that such usability choices are highly debatable and we cannot change them in stable releases as soon as someone finds a certain choice "weird" ;-) Stable versions receive bugfixes for validated bugs exclusively, and this one is the very definition of a "Wishlist" request. Feel free to request a custom patch for these kind of issues via OPW, but they cannot be merged in official stable versions... I hope this clarifies a bit the reasons for rejecting the merge proposal. -- https://code.launchpad.net/~openerp-dev/openobject-addons/6.1-opw-578572-ado/+merge/121771 Your team OpenERP R&D Team is subscribed to branch lp:~openerp-dev/openobject-addons/6.1-opw-578572-ado. _______________________________________________ Mailing list: https://launchpad.net/~openerp-dev-gtk Post to : [email protected] Unsubscribe : https://launchpad.net/~openerp-dev-gtk More help : https://help.launchpad.net/ListHelp

